What Are the Hallmarks of a Top Online Bachelor’s in Cybersecurity?

The best online undergraduate programs in cybersecurity combine in-depth technical coursework, hands-on labs, and preparation for professional certification with a flexible plan of study and proven career outcomes & job placements for alumni.

Here are the quality markers that you will see in our 2026 rankings of the top 20 online bachelor’s degrees in cybersecurity:

  • Accreditation: In addition to regional accreditation for the university, some schools have also earned ABET accreditation for their bachelor’s program in cybersecurity through ABET’s Computing Accreditation Commission (CAC).
  • CAE Designations: All of the programs in our rankings have earned designations from the National Centers of Academic Excellence in Cybersecurity (NCAE-C) program from the NSA. The most popular designation is Cyber Defense (CAE-CD), but some schools have pursued designations in Cyber Operations (CAE-CO) and Research (CAE-R). And a few have earned all 3 designations!
  • Industry-Aligned Curriculum: A bachelor’s degree in cybersecurity should feature up-to-date coursework that includes training in fundamental computing, programming & networking concepts; the latest cybersecurity tools & methods; modern security threats & defenses; cyber AI and the cloud; and risk, governance & compliance issues. CyberAI-validated programs will be particularly strong in AI issues.
  • Hands-On Training & Practicums: The most useful cybersecurity undergraduate programs contain virtual labs, simulations, cyber ranges, and real-world projects, as well as opportunities to participate in cyber clubs, red/blue team exercises & Capture The Flag (CTF) competitions.
  • Internships & Co-Opportunities: Strong undergraduate programs in cybersecurity have mandatory internship & co-op opportunities built into the curriculum. Online students can take part in internships locally or virtually.
  • Capstone Projects: Most top cybersecurity programs at the undergraduate level include a final capstone project where students can work on a real-world security challenge with an industry partner.
  • Faculty Expertise: Professors should be accredited cybersecurity professionals currently working in the field.
  • Certification Preparation: Some online bachelor’s programs in cybersecurity will include preparation for—and discounts on—industry certifications (e.g. Security+)
  • Research Credibility: Look for universities that have funded their own cybersecurity research centers and often receive NSA-funded research grants.
  • Verifiable Career Outcomes: The best online bachelor’s degrees in cybersecurity achieve excellent job placement rates and have established connections to employers & industry partners, including federal agencies & DoD contractors. Ask the program coordinator for graduate outcome data.

When in doubt, speak to recent or current students before you make a decision. We also recommend checking LinkedIn to see what cybersecurity roles alumni have pursued after graduation.

Why Earn an Online Bachelor’s Degree in Cybersecurity?

The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) is predicting a 29% growth in jobs for Information Security Analysts from 2024-2034, much faster than the national average. According to ISC2 survey respondents, AI has caused a substantial increase in cyber threats and is rapidly changing the scope & nature of cybersecurity tasks. Now more than ever, trained professionals are needed to protect the world from harm.

But it pays to do your homework before you earn an academic qualification. Cybersecurity is an intensely competitive field and most employers are looking for candidates with prior work experience. Although ISC2 Cybersecurity Workforce Studies indicate that there is an ongoing workforce gap in cybersecurity positions, budget cuts, automation, and layoffs are severely affecting job prospects for entry-level cybersecurity professionals.

That’s why our rankings focus so strongly on bachelor’s degrees in cybersecurity with elements such as internships, cooperative experiences, and industry partnerships. A strong online undergraduate program with a CAE designation will help you accrue workplace experience and valuable career connections before you graduate.

Core Elements of an Online Cybersecurity Bachelor’s Degree

Admissions Process

Baseline Requirements

Universities are usually happy to accept a wide range of candidates into a Bachelor of Science in Cybersecurity. In fact, many bachelor’s degrees in cybersecurity are designed for working professionals, continuing education students, and military servicemembers.

Generally speaking, schools will be looking for:

  • Educational Background: High school diploma or the equivalent (GED). Degree completion programs may ask for proof of an associate degree or equivalent credits & experience.
  • GPA: Each school will have a different minimum threshold. It can range from 2.0 to 3.0 or more.
  • Standardized Test Scores: Some universities will ask for SAT or ACT scores; some make these tests optional.
  • Prerequisite Coursework: Candidates will usually be expected to provide proof of high school courses in mathematics (e.g. Calculus), science (e.g. Physics), computer science fundamentals, English, and social sciences.

Some undergraduate cybersecurity degree programs will also request to see letters of recommendation, a personal statement or essay, and your résumé. Non-native English speakers will usually be expected to submit proof of language proficiency through test scores (e.g. TOEFL or IELTS).

Credit Transfers

If you have any previous experience, find out if you qualify for credit transfers. You may be able to transfer a large number of credits into your BS in Cybersecurity for a wide variety of reasons. These may include:

  • Previous College-Level Coursework
  • Professional Certifications
  • Military Education & Experience
  • Standardized Exams
  • Workplace Learning
  • Google Certificates
  • Vocational & Technical Training

Common Course Requirements

Core Coursework

Core courses for a BS in Cybersecurity will often be split between fundamental concepts in computing & networks and security-specific topics. In the first few years, you will be tackling courses such as:

  • Programming
  • Discrete Mathematics
  • Operating Systems
  • Networks
  • System Administration
  • Linux Fundamentals

Once you’ve mastered skills in computing & networks, you can start to address how to protect them, with courses in areas such as:

  • Network Security
  • Operating System Security
  • Cloud Computing Security
  • Mobile Security
  • AI & Security
  • Intrusion Detection & Incident Response
  • Ethical Hacking & Penetration Testing
  • Digital Forensics
  • Introduction to Cryptography
  • Cybersecurity Policies & Ethics

Each BS degree will have its own unique slant, so we recommend examining the curriculum links carefully before you make a decision.

What to Look For in Coursework

Even if universities are offering the same cybersecurity courses, they may not be delivering them in the same way. It’s important to establish whether you’d like to acquire fundamental theoretical knowledge in your classes or you’d really like to focus on hands-on applications.

For instance, one SNHU alumnus has noted that the CAE-validated Online Bachelor of Science in Cybersecurity leans toward theory and away from offensive skills:

“All of the theory is applicable and some of the labs are handy. Please note this is cybersecurity, if you are looking for hands on network administration, server administration, hacking or penetration etc – really anything that isn’t theory – this is not the degree path for you.”

Always talk to recent BS alumni to get a sense of whether the core coursework has proved applicable to the workplace.

Tip: We particularly favor universities that provide a full list of software, technical platforms, and programming languages that are included in the curriculum.

Program Structure & Activities

Hands-On Labs

The best bachelor’s programs in cybersecurity balance training in fundamental theoretical concepts with hands-on experiences in labs and security simulations. Universities like to boast about hands-on training, so you will need to ask around to decide how serious they are.

You can supplement any gaps in your skill sets by training on outside platforms such as TryHackMe, but that will be an extra level of commitment. Talk to alumni and ask if you can monitor a lab before you commit to the degree.

Certification Preparation

Look for schools that embed preparation for cybersecurity certifications into the curriculum. WGU is the most famous example—the CAE-validated Online Bachelor of Science in Cybersecurity and Information Assurance includes prep for 16 industry certifications within the plan of study. But there are plenty more (e.g. NEIT). Before you apply, ask the program coordinator for a list of certifications that BS students commonly earn.

Internships

Recent high school graduates should prioritize bachelor’s programs in cybersecurity that include internship opportunities with well-known companies. Although a self-paced program like WGU may be popular with working professionals, it won’t help as much with career networking. As one alumnus noted:

“The real advantages I’ve seen from the UTSA BBA vs WGU are the local internship opportunities. I’ve seen a large number of folks finishing the BBA, getting an internship at my company, then being hired full time. My WGU post-placement experience was the “Handshake” program, where I was relentlessly pursued for helpdesk-type roles.”

In our rankings, we’ve noted which undergraduate programs have mandatory internships embedded in the curriculum. However, universities like UTSA also offer internships through their cybersecurity research & education centers. For example, UMGC’s Center for Security Studies has developed training and internship opportunities for undergraduates.

Co-Op Experiences

Co-operative education combines classroom-based training with practical work experience. For a stellar example of an undergraduate degree in cybersecurity that features co-ops, have a look at the University of Cincinnati’s CAE-validated Bachelor of Science in Cybersecurity.

Beginning in the second year, students in the BS program are required to alternate semesters of classroom instruction with semesters of full-time, paid work in the IT industry. By the time they graduate, cybersecurity students at UC have the equivalent of 1+ years of professional experience.

Cyber Clubs & Competitions

When possible, get involved in the university’s cybersecurity clubs and put your hand up to participate in cyber competitions. For example, UMGC’s Cybersecurity Competition Team is composed of students, alumni, and faculty. The team trains in UMGC’s Virtual Security Lab and regularly participates in MAGIC CTF and Hack the Box.

You can also ask the program coordinator if the university is affiliated with any cyber organizations. For example, Old Dominion University and Norfolk State University have close ties to the Coastal Virginia Cybersecurity Student Association (CVCSA). The CVCSA hosts CyberForge, an annual conference and CTF event for students.

Capstone/Final Project

Many bachelor’s programs in cybersecurity culminate in a capstone or senior-year project. This will usually have a significant research component. There are scores of examples out there, but the trick is finding a topic that will prepare you for the job market.

Start talking to your BS professors as soon as you’ve established where your passions lie. Preparation is nine-tenths of the game:

  • Can you partner with a prestigious company or organization that’s attached to the university’s cybersecurity center?
  • What real-world projects would be appropriate for an entry-level security analyst to tackle?
  • If you are working with a team of students, what role do you wish to assume?

Who Should Earn an Online Bachelor’s Degree in Cybersecurity?

Job Pathways for Bachelor’s in Cybersecurity Degree Graduates

Here is a list of common job titles for entry-level cybersecurity roles. Many employers will also be looking for a certain number of years of work experience and relevant industry certifications:

  • Cybersecurity Analyst
  • Cybersecurity Specialist (Apprentice)
  • Security Analyst
  • Information Security Engineer/Analyst
  • Junior SOC Analyst
  • Entry-Level Penetration Tester (Ethical Hacking)
  • Entry-Level Cybersecurity Engineer

In a challenging job market, cybersecurity graduates also end up applying for IT support, system administrator & help desk positions. According to one academic:

“Most of the graduates from our cybersecurity BSc program (a heavy technical one) are currently employed in various roles spanning from IT admins to instructors and anything in between. About 30% stick with SOC analyst roles or roles like security engineer. I’ve seen some also taking roles as IAM admins and even consultants, compliance and auditing. Also, some have had classified jobs with Uncle Sam.”

Remember that you have the option to start in a relevant IT position and use that time to earn an online cybersecurity master’s degree, accrue work experience, and improve your hiring chances. That’s why we’ve highlighted accelerated master’s degree pathways in our rankings. Average Salaries for Bachelor’s in Cybersecurity Graduates

One of the most reliable sources for cybersecurity salary data is the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) and its occupational profile of Information and Security Analysts. To give yourself the full picture, you can use AI to compare these figures with salary estimates on sites like Glassdoor.

In May 2024, these were the BLS’s national wage estimates for information and security analysts:

Percentile 10% 25% 50% 75% 90%
Hourly Wage $33.49 $44.31 $60.05 $76.73 $89.63
Annual Wage $69,660 $92,160 $124,910 $159,600 $186,420

It’s important to note that these are national averages. In 2024, the top 5 states with the highest mean wages for information security analysts were:

  • California
  • Idaho
  • Maryland
  • Washington
  • New Jersey

California is home to Silicon Valley; Maryland is a federal hotspot; and New Jersey is closely linked to NYC and its fintech sector. The spike in Idaho’s cybersecurity wages could be attributed to defense-related and federal cybersecurity projects in places like the Idaho National Laboratory (INL).

In May 2024, top-paying metropolitan and non-metropolitan areas for information security analysts included:

  • San Jose
  • San Francisco
  • Boulder
  • Thousand Oaks-Ventura (LA)
  • Seattle

Keep in mind that all of these cities also have a massive stake in artificial intelligence & cyber AI. When you’re thinking about earning potential, think about the cost of living as well. San Francisco may pay well, but that’s partly to cover the sky-high rents.

What Are the Most Important Skills to Learn in an Online Bachelor’s in Cybersecurity?

The most important skills to learn in an undergraduate cybersecurity degree will depend on the roles that you’re eyeing, as well as AI developments. The security skills that are in-demand today may be obsolete in two years.

With that caution in mind, here are a few skill sets that entry-level cybersecurity professionals may currently be expected to have:

  • Networking Fundamentals: Including a thorough knowledge of network administration & systems administration
  • Operating Systems: Including proficiency in Windows, Linux, and Unix systems
  • Scripting and Programming Skills: Including proficiency in Python and PowerShell
  • Network Security: Including an understanding of firewalls, VPNs, and intrusion detection systems
  • Cloud & Modern Infrastructure Security: Including an understanding of AWS/Azure fundamentals and cloud misfiguration risk
  • Security Operations & Incident Response: Including tasks like log analysis, SIEM triage workflows, basic forensics & evidence handling, and incident reports
  • Technical Proficiency with Security Tools: Including tools like Splunk, Snort, Wireshark, and many more
  • Compliance, Risk & Governance: Including knowledge of risk assessment basics, NIST/CIS frameworks, and security policies & standards
  • Soft Skills: Including communication, technical writing, analytical thinking, and program-solving skills
Tip: Pick 3-5 cybersecurity roles that you aspire to and reverse engineer your search. Ask AI to scan all the current job listings for those roles and list the required skill sets that employers are demanding. Then see if the curriculum for your BS matches up.

AI’s Role in Cybersecurity: A Key Differentiator for 2026

The Effects of AI on Cybersecurity Jobs

There’s no question that AI is going to have an impact on your cybersecurity education and plans after graduation. Respondents to the 2025 ISC2 Cybersecurity Workforce Study noted AI is now actively being deployed by cybersecurity teams for time-intensive tasks such as:

  • Network monitoring
  • Security operations & testing
  • Vulnerability management
  • Threat modeling
  • Endpoint protection & response

Most of these areas are ripe for automation.

The effects of AI on cybersecurity job responsibiities will be particularly noticeable for those in their early career. According to Gartner’s Top Eight Cybersecurity Predictions for 2024, by 2028, “the adoption of GenAI will collapse the skills gap, removing the need for specialized education from 50% of entry-level cybersecurity positions.”

The Rise of AI-Related Cybersecurity Jobs

But the arrival of artificial intelligence doesn’t mean that cybersecurity professionals have gone the way of the dodo. Instead, AI has accelerated the arms race between malevolents who are using artificial intelligence to increase attacks and cybersecurity experts who are using it to deploy countermeasures.

  • In a recent 2025 ISC2 Cybersecurity Workforce Study, AI and cloud computing security were ranked #1 and #2 in the list of Top Security Team Skills Needs.
  • In a 2025 Cybersecurity Skills Gap report from Fortinet Training Institute, 48% of respondents reported that a lack of staff with sufficient AI expertise was the biggest challenge for IT decision-makers.

In response, unique cyber AI roles are emerging that require strategic, interdisciplinary skills. For example:

  • In a 2024 opinion piece for StationX, Will AI Replace Cyber Security Jobs? The new Cyber Future, Adam Goss suggested that the arrival of new technologies would “lead to new types of cyber security jobs, such as AI security analysts or machine learning security engineers.”
  • Mike Elgan of SecurityIntelligence would append titles like AI cybersecurity specialists and cybersecurity data scientists to this list.

This means emerging professionals should be developing expertise in AI & ML, analytics, data science, and data governance alongside their cybersecurity skills early in their career. The line between AI and cyber is growing increasingly blurred.

FAQ

What Bachelor’s Degree is Best for Cybersecurity?

Employers are usually willing to consider a number of undergraduate majors for entry-level cybersecurity positions. However, in addition to cybersecurity knowledge, they will expect candidates to have fundamental technical skills in computing, networking, and operating systems. They will also heavily favor job applicants with real-world experience and relevant certifications.

  • Recent High School Graduates: Before you commit to a four-year degree in cybersecurity, compare them to the alternative majors that we have listed below. Unless you’re being funded by your employer or a scholarship program like CyberCorps® SFS, you should consider a number of majors.
  • Working Professionals: If you are a working professional who is simply looking for an on-campus or online degree completion program that focuses solely on cybersecurity skills, there are plenty of options in our rankings and listings.

What Are Alternatives to a Bachelor’s Degree in Cybersecurity?

Popular alternatives to an undergraduate degree in cybersecurity include:

  • Bachelor of Science in Computer Science (BSCS)
  • Bachelor of Science in Information Technology (BSIT)
  • Bachelor of Science in Information Systems (BSIS)
  • Bachelor of Science in Computer Engineering (BSCE)

You can customize any of these majors with a concentration and/or electives in cybersecurity (e.g. George Mason University’s on-campus, CAE-validated BSIT – Cyber Security).

Tip: Remember that you can pursue a double major in cybersecurity and a related discipline. You also have the option to earn an associate’s degree in IT or a related discipline before completing your bachelor’s in cybersecurity.

Should I Consider a For-Profit School Like SANS?

Possibly. SANS Technology Institute is a private, for-profit company that offers a popular Bachelor’s in Applied Cybersecurity (BACS). This two-year, online degree completion program includes a field experience and portfolio practicum, and will prepare you for 9 GIAC certifications.

  • SANS holds a CAE-CD designation for the CAE-validated MS in Information Security Engineering, so it’s not an academic slouch. It also accepts the GI Bill.
  • Some alumni rate it highly, but they also mention the high cost. You may find cheaper options from a regionally accredited university within your state or online.

Other well-known for-profit options with CAE-CD designations include Capella University and American Public University.

What Does NCAE-C Stand For?

NCAE-C stands for the National Centers of Academic Excellence in Cybersecurity (NCAE-C) program. This program is managed by the NSA’s National Cryptologic School, in partnership with other federal agencies (e.g. USCYBERCOM).

What Are CAE Designations?

The NCAE-C program has established rigorous standards for cybersecurity education & academic excellence. It awards CAE designations to specific cybersecurity degrees & certificates in three categories:

  • CAE-CD (Cyber Defense): This is the most common designation. It’s awarded to strong cybersecurity degrees and/or certificates at the associate, bachelor’s and graduate levels that are offered by regionally accredited academic institutions.
  • CAE-CO (Cyber Operations): This is the hardest designation to earn. It’s awarded to technical, interdisciplinary, higher education programs that are firmly grounded in computer science, computer engineering, and/or electrical engineering disciplines. Programs must provide extensive opportunities for hands-on applications (via labs and exercises) and focus on both offensive & defensive cyber operations.
  • CAE-R (Research): This is given to Department of Defense (DoD) schools, PhD-producing military academies, and regionally accredited, degree granting four-year institutions rated by the Carnegie Classification as having highest, higher or moderate research activity.

What is a CAE-Validated Program?

A CAE-validated program of study (POS) is a specific degree or academic program that has met the academic requirements & cybersecurity standards established by the NCAE-C program. If you explore the profiles in the CAE Institution Map, you’ll notice that only certain degrees and certificates are listed as being CAE-validated.

Tip: Some Online BS in Cybersecurity programs in our rankings are CAE-validated; some are not. If you feel that the online degree is not going to be rigorous enough for your needs, we’ve provided a link to the CAE-validated on-campus alternative.

What is a CyberAI-Validated Program?

In 2025, the NSA launched a new validation for programs of study called CyberAI. This recognizes programs that have demonstrated excellence in integrating AI training into their cybersecurity programs. In order to qualify for CyberAI validation, schools must already hold a current CAE Cyber Defense (CAE-CD) or a CAE Cyber Operations (CAE-CO) designation. CyberAI programs are judged on two separate criteria:

  • AICyber: Deploying AI to support traditional cybersecurity goals & enhance defense
  • SecureAI: Securing AI systems and infrastructure throughout their lifecycle

Old Dominion University was the first university in the USA to receive AICyber and SecureAI recognitions. Its Online Bachelor of Science in Cybersecurity stands at #12 in our 2026 rankings. Other schools in our cybersecurity rankings, such as the University of Arizona, offer a separate online bachelor’s degree in AI that has been validated for CyberAI.

What Cybersecurity Certifications Should I Pursue?

Some of the most common certifications for entry-level cybersecurity professionals are offered by CompTIA, including:

  • CompTIA A+
  • CompTIA Linux+
  • CompTIA Networking+
  • CompTIA Security+
  • CompTIA CySA+

Many cybersecurity professionals also end up pursuing higher-level certifications such as:

  • CISSP (Certified Information Systems Security Professional) from ISC2
  • CISA (Certified Information System Auditor) from ISACA
  • CEH (Certified Ethical Hacker) from EC-Council
  • GIAC Security Certifications

See Cyberseek’s Cybersecurity Supply/Demand Heat Map for an up-to-date list of the most requested certifications for cyber job openings. Security+ and CISSP usually appear in the top 2.

It’s important to prioritize the most relevant ones. As one student noted in their review of WGU’s program and its certification preparation: 

“Some of the certs are really useless, you won’t see too many job postings looking for Linux Essentials, PenTest+, CYSA, SSCP, CCSP. Vendor specific certs from Splunk, Cisco, AWS, and Azure are way more in demand or the CEH.”

Always check current job descriptions to see what’s truly required for your preferred job role. And remember that certifications are only one part of the puzzle. There are plenty of over-qualified, over-certified professionals out there who are finding it hard to secure a position.

How Much Does an Online Cybersecurity Degree Cost?

The cost of an online bachelor’s degree in cybersecurity can range from under $30,000 at a select few universities to $80,000+ at other schools. However, there are many ways to reduce the cost of your undergraduate education in cybersecurity, including:

  • In-state tuition at a university within your state
  • Cybersecurity scholarships
  • Federal & state grants
  • Credit transfers for certifications & prior learning
  • Military benefits & tuition discounts (often $250 per credit)
  • Powering through a competency-based program like WGU
  • Working while you study part-time
